Common Roof Problems Maintenance Can Catch Early

Open Seams

Open seams are common on flat and low-slope commercial roofs. Once a seam begins to separate, water can move under the membrane and travel before showing up inside the building.

Clogged Drains

Houston rain can quickly expose poor drainage. Clogged drains, gutters, and scuppers can lead to ponding water, roof stress, and moisture problems.

Loose Flashing

Flashing protects roof edges, walls, penetrations, and rooftop equipment. When flashing becomes loose or cracked, water can enter through these weak points.

Surface Damage

Punctures, cuts, blisters, cracks, and worn areas can happen from foot traffic, storm debris, HVAC work, or age. Small damage should be addressed before it spreads.

Rooftop Leaks

HVAC units, vents, pipes, and curbs are common leak areas. These details need careful inspection because they involve seams, sealants, transitions, and penetrations.

Most commercial roofs should be inspected at least once or twice a year. Roofs with leak history, heavy foot traffic, rooftop equipment, or storm exposure may need more frequent maintenance.

Maintenance may include checking seams, drains, flashing, roof penetrations, rooftop equipment areas, ponding water, punctures, surface wear, and previous repair areas.

Yes, maintenance can help prevent many leaks by catching small issues early. It cannot stop every problem, but it can reduce avoidable damage and emergency repairs.

Yes, if the roof is still serviceable. Maintenance can help manage aging roof systems, but if the roof has widespread failure or wet insulation, replacement may be a better option.

Yes. Flat and low-slope roofs need regular drainage checks because standing water, clogged drains, and open seams can lead to serious problems over time.
